Hej eksperter. Jeg vil gerne vide hvordan jeg hiver feltet, email ud fra table2 om smider det ind i table1. I begge tabeler hedder feltet email
SELECT email INTO table1 FROM table2 -> virker ikke SELECT email INTO table1.email FROM table2 -> virker ikke SELECT table2.email INTO table1.email FROM table2 -> virker ikke
UPDATE table1, table2 SET table1.email = table2.email WHERE table1.felt1 = table2.felt1
I andre SQL databaser er den foretrukne måde:
UPDATE table1 SET email = (SELECT email FROM table2 WHERE felt1 = table1.felt1)
hvor felt1 er det felt som knytter de to tabeller sammen.
Synes godt om
Ny brugerNybegynder
Din løsning...
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.